The Benefits of Small-Scale Industries: Driving Local Economies and Empowering Communities

Small-scale industries are businesses with limited investment, typically operating on a smaller scale compared to large enterprises. According to the small-scale industries definition, these businesses are characterized by their labor-intensive operations, local ownership, and minimal capital requirements. The benefits of small-scale industries are numerous, including job creation, promotion of local talent, and fostering entrepreneurship. 

Small-scale industries contribute significantly to the economy by generating employment, supporting local supply chains, and reducing regional imbalances. Moreover, they provide a platform for innovation and adaptability, crucial for sustaining economic growth. Employment Generation

Employment generation is one of the key advantages of small-scale industries. These industries play a crucial role in providing jobs to a large number of people. By producing a wide range of small-scale industries products, they create opportunities for skilled and unskilled labor.

Flexibility and Adaptability

One of the key advantages of small-scale industries is their flexibility and adaptability. Small-scale industries products can be quickly adjusted to meet changing market demands, allowing businesses to stay competitive and relevant. Small businesses can swiftly pivot their strategies, adopt new technologies, and respond to consumer trends with minimal bureaucracy.

Low Capital Investment

One of the significant benefits of small-scale industries is the low capital investment required to start and operate them. These enterprises typically need minimal financial resources, making them accessible to a broader range of entrepreneurs. 

Small-scale industries’ benefits include the ability to grow gradually, reinvesting profits to expand operations. This characteristic makes them resilient and sustainable, providing a solid foundation for local economies and community development.

Reduces Regional Imbalances

Small-scale industries play a vital role in reducing regional imbalances by promoting industrialization in less developed areas. By establishing various types of small-scale industries in rural and semi-urban regions, these enterprises help distribute economic activities more evenly across the country. 

Accessing small scale industries information reveals that these industries bring jobs, infrastructure, and investment to areas that are often overlooked by larger businesses. This not only boosts local economies but also curbs migration to urban centers, fostering balanced regional growth. Disadvantages of small scale industries

Limited Resources

Small-scale industries often face resource constraints, including financial and technical limitations, which can hinder their growth compared to larger firms and new business ventures with more extensive resources.

Market Reach Limitations

Due to their smaller scale, these industries may struggle with limited market reach and distribution channels, which can restrict their ability to compete effectively and leverage small business benefits.

Vulnerability to Economic Fluctuations

Small-scale industries are more susceptible to economic downturns and market fluctuations, affecting their stability and profitability compared to larger businesses with more robust financial buffers.

Challenges in Scaling Up

Scaling up operations can be challenging for small-scale industries due to limited capital and infrastructure, which may restrict their ability to expand and capitalize on new business opportunities.
